First off, what exactly is shear strength? Well, shear strength refers to the ability of a material to resist forces that cause its internal structure to slide against itself. In the context of pipe repair putty, it's the measure of how well the putty can withstand forces that try to make different parts of it move parallel to each other.
When you're dealing with pipes, there are all sorts of forces at play. For example, if a pipe is underground and there's soil movement, it can put shear forces on any repair putty that's been applied. Or, in an industrial setting, vibrations from machinery can also create shear stresses on the pipe and the repair putty.
So, why does the shear strength of pipe repair putty matter? It's simple. If the putty doesn't have sufficient shear strength, it won't be able to hold up under these forces. This can lead to the repair failing, which means leaks, downtime, and potentially costly repairs. You definitely don't want that!
Now, let's talk about what affects the shear strength of pipe repair putty. One of the main factors is the formulation of the putty. Different manufacturers use different ingredients and ratios, which can have a big impact on the shear strength. For instance, some putties might have a higher concentration of strong bonding agents, which can increase their shear resistance.
Another factor is the curing process. How the putty cures can also influence its shear strength. If it cures too quickly or too slowly, it might not develop the optimal internal structure to resist shear forces. That's why it's important to follow the manufacturer's instructions when it comes to curing time and conditions.
Surface preparation is also key. If the surface of the pipe isn't properly cleaned and prepped before applying the putty, the bond between the putty and the pipe won't be as strong. This can reduce the overall shear strength of the repair. So, make sure to remove any dirt, grease, or rust from the pipe surface before you start.
